    Notes (I should do more research about these, but just off the top of my head):

    - If what the authorities are saying is true, it would be one of the first of this type of case in the UAE.

    - Homicide is extremely rare in the UAE. Cameras are everywhere and everyone knows that. Security is super tight. Police on call all the time. Surveillance is best in the world I would say, partly because the population is so small and the resources and motive so huge.

    - Executions are very rare in the UAE. I'm currently trying to figure out if any female has ever been executed here in the past 43 years.

    - Important to note the UAE has actively been involved in various military campaigns in Afghanistan, Iraq, Syria and Libya. These efforts have really accelerated in the last few years.

    - Another important event which may or may not be related is the UAE crackdown on the activists who requested greater power for the Federal National Council during the Arab Spring. These activists - judges, lawyers, professors, and other citizens - were later deemed to be Muslim Brotherhood agents with plans to launch attacks in the UAE. We have not seen any evidence of this, the trials were heavily controlled and the defendants claimed they did not get appropriate legal counsel or treatment. Truth is, we know very little and we're told that's in protection of national security and our own best interest. It is very interesting for me to know if this woman is affiliated with the Brotherhood.

    - Following the trial of those activists, there has been a heavy handed government effort to denounce high levels of religiosity, and also a huge effort (with the aid of massive US public relations firms) to promote nationalism (UAE national day was two days ago).

    - The UAE and Qatar have had shaky relations over the last couple of years due to differences regarding the treatment of Muslim Brotherhood members. I don't know if it's related at all, but UAE and Qatar have started to mend the relationship and I wonder if members of the Muslim Brotherhood would have a motive to disrupt the improvement of relations between the two countries.

    - The face veil is not common attire in the UAE, especially not in Abu Dhabi. Maybe 15% of women. Among those who wear it, many are young women who are avoiding being seen by their families in public.

    - Obsessive drive by authorities to point out that the woman was veiled, even inventing a nickname for the murderer.

    - Most of what is known about this case is relayed only through the authorities. If history is any indication, the woman will never speak to anyone or have any semblance of legal counsel because the UAE authorities place a high value on national security.
